In terms of performance, this Plate Heat Exchanger is recognized as a high efficiency plate heat exchanger. Its design incorporates multiple thin, corrugated plates that create a large surface area for heat transfer while promoting turbulent flow, which significantly enhances the heat exchange rate. This design not only improves thermal efficiency but also ensures minimal temperature differentials between the fluids, optimizing energy usage and reducing operational costs.

The condenser coil function of this Plate Heat Exchanger is particularly noteworthy. It efficiently condenses vapor into liquid by transferring heat to a cooling medium, which is crucial in refrigeration, air conditioning, and various process industries.
